FBI agents search McNamara offices FBI agents raided Wayne County executive offices at 600 Randolph and The Friends of McNamara office at 400 Monroe in Detroit on Friday searching for documents that may indicate county employees were doing political work on county time. Three Friends of McNamara employees also were subpoenaed to appear before a grand jury, County Executive Ed McNamara said.

McNamara said agents did not search his office Friday. But he was among the 25 people named as parties in the three suites of offices subject to the federal search warrant. Others were Deputy County Executive Mary Zuckerman, Chief of Staff Eddie McDonald, several assistant county executives and McNamara's executive secretary.
